2. Metallurgical Science: Alloy Composition and Thermal Performance
To specify high-performance cookware, buyers must understand the atomic breakdown of stainless steel alloys. Stainless steel is an iron-based alloy containing a minimum of 10.5% chromium, which forms a self-healing passive layer of chromium oxide ($Cr_2O_3$) that prevents atmospheric and aqueous corrosion. However, varying ratios of nickel, molybdenum, and carbon dramatically alter the material's mechanical strength and chemical stability.
Stainless Steel Alloy Comparison Matrix
| Steel Grade | Composition (Cr / Ni / Mo) | Structure Type | Corrosion Resistance | Thermal Efficiency | Primary B2B Application |
|---|---|---|---|---|---|
| AISI 304 (18/8 - 18/10) | 18-20% Cr, 8-10.5% Ni | Austenitic | High (Organic Acids & Steam) | Moderate (16.2 W/m·K) | Standard Commercial Cooking & Retail Sets |
| AISI 316 (18/12 Mo) | 16-18% Cr, 10-14% Ni, 2-3% Mo | Austenitic | Exceptional (Saline & High Acid) | Moderate (15.0 W/m·K) | Marine HORECA, High-Salinity Sauce Pots |
| AISI 430 (18/0) | 16-18% Cr, 0-0.75% Ni | Ferritic (Magnetic) | Moderate (Atmospheric) | Higher (26.0 W/m·K) | Induction Bottom Outer Caps & Budget Cutlery |
| Tri-Ply Clad (304-Al-430) | Multi-Layer Cladding | Composite | High Interior / Magnetic Exterior | Superior (Core 205 W/m·K) | Professional Chef Skillets & Sauté Pans |
While AISI 304 (18/10) remains the industry benchmark for food contact surfaces due to its exceptional resistance to organic acids, food juices, and aggressive commercial dishwasher chemicals, it possesses low thermal conductivity (approx. 16 W/m·K). Pure iron or copper conducts heat significantly faster, but lacks chemical inertness. To solve this physical limitation, advanced cookware engineering utilizes composite multi-layer bonding.
Encapsulated Bottom vs. Full-Body Tri-Ply Cladding
When evaluating structural design for wholesale orders, procurement managers must match the construction method to the end-user culinary application:
- Impact-Bonded Capsule Base: Consists of a heavy aluminum core disk (ranging from 4.0mm to 7.0mm) sandwiched between an interior AISI 304 cooking surface and an exterior AISI 430 magnetic cap. Under 1,500 to 2,500 tons of hydraulic friction bonding, the aluminum flows into the micro-cavities of the steel, forming a seamless joint. This construction is highly cost-effective and ideal for deep stockpots, saucepots, and boiling vessels where heat transfer is primarily vertical.
- Tri-Ply Full-Body Clad: Formed by bonding a continuous sheet of pure aluminum (or aluminum alloy 3003) between interior 304 stainless steel and exterior 430 magnetic steel. Heat travels rapidly sideways up the entire body wall. This eliminates side-wall thermal lag, preventing delicate sauces from scorching and providing precise temperature control critical for sautéing and frying operations.

Trend C: Induction Efficiency Optimization for Commercial All-Electric Kitchens
Decarbonization policies worldwide are encouraging commercial restaurants to swap gas lines for high-power induction cooktops. Cookware engineered for 2025 and beyond must feature perfectly flat bottom flatness tolerance (<0.10mm concave dynamic ratio at 300°C) to prevent magnetic buzz, optimize energy transfer, and protect delicate induction glass ceramic surfaces from scratch abrasion.
5. Precision Manufacturing & Quality Engineering Protocols
Our manufacturing facility in Bandung operates under rigorous process controls designed to eliminate structural defects, micro-pitting, and rim delamination. Below is an overview of our quality assurance pipeline:
- Spectrometric Raw Material Verification: Every coil of cold-rolled stainless steel undergoes X-ray fluorescence (XRF) spectrometry upon factory receipt to verify exact chromium, nickel, and molybdenum content before entering deep-drawing presses.
- Deep-Draw Hydraulic Stamping: Utilizing multi-stage hydraulic presses with synthetic water-soluble lubricants to prevent micro-fissures during high-ratio wall stretching.
- Friction Impact-Bonding: Base plates are joined under temperatures exceeding 550°C and pressures above 2,000 metric tons, producing an unyielding atomic bond between the aluminum disc and steel layers.
- Automated Multi-Stage Polishing & Passivation: Automated mechanical buffing produces Ra-controlled finishes, followed by an acid passivation bath that strips free iron particles from the surface, enhancing natural rust resistance.
- Destructive Joint & Leak Testing: Randomly sampled units undergo handle torque-shear tests (exceeding 250 kgf pull force) and thermal shock cycles (heating to 300°C followed by immediate water quenching).
